Matplotlib change the bar color if a condition is met

问题:

I am trying to build a Figure with 2 subplots.

If the Item is in ax and ax1 the color of the bar is blue.
If the item is in ax and not in ax1 the bar color should be green.
If the item is not in ax and it is in ax1 the bar color should be red. so in my example:

The bar Exploit should be green and XSS should be red.

Is there a way to do this with Matplotlib?

Here is the code:

回答1:

You can change the color of the Rectangle patches that barh creates after its been plotted based on your conditions.

I modified your code a little to remove some of the unnecessary parts and make it run. I hope its clear below what its doing. You can use ax.patch[i].set_color('r') to change the color of patch i to red, for example.

import matplotlib.pyplot as plt from collections import OrderedDict  fig,(ax1,ax2) = plt.subplots(1,2)  Testdic1 =OrderedDict([('Exploit', 14664), ('Botnet', 123), ('Virus', 52)]) Testdic2 =OrderedDict([('Botnet', 1252), ('Virus', 600), ('XSS', 452)])  list1 = list(Testdic1.items()) list2 = list(Testdic2.items())  n1 = len(list1) n2 = len(list2)  values1 = [v for l,v in list1] values2 = [v for l,v in list2]  ax1.barh(range(n1),values1,align='center', fc='#80d0f1', ec='w') ax2.barh(range(n2),values2,align='center', fc='#80d0f1', ec='w')  # ==================================== # Here's where we change colors # ==================================== for i,(label,val) in enumerate(list1):     if label.title() in Testdic2:         pass # leave it blue     else:         ax1.patches[i].set_color('g') for i,(label,val) in enumerate(list2):     if label.title() in Testdic1:         pass # leave it blue     else:         ax2.patches[i].set_color('r') # ====================================  ax1.set_yticks(range(n1)) ax2.set_yticks(range(n2))  for i, (label, val) in enumerate(list1):     ax1.annotate(label.title(), xy=(10, i), fontsize=10, va='center')  for i, (label, val) in enumerate(list2):     ax2.annotate(label.title(), xy=(10, i), fontsize=10, va='center')  ax1.invert_yaxis() ax2.invert_yaxis()  plt.show()
